On Tue, 2008-06-10 at 15:40 -0700, Timothy Selivanow wrote:
When run with '-debug', I see *lots* of the following
errors:
Caused by: org.apache.commons.logging.LogConfigurationException:
org.apache.commons.logging.LogConfigurationException:
org.apache.commons.logging.LogConfigurationException: Invalid class
loader hierarchy. You have more than one version of
'org.apache.commons.logging.Log' visible, which is not allowed.
When I use upstream's ant and set ANT_HOME to that, the error does not
occur and the build succeeds.
OK, so I decided to see how far the Fedora<->JPackage work has gone and
install the JPackage repo in F9...in addition to no conflicts like I had
experienced in earlier Fedora versions (good job Jesse and Fernando, and
any one else working on that BTW), it fixed the problem I saw. Below is
a partial yum out put of what it did (I also tried to clean it up a bit
as it didn't copy into the email nicely, limited space and all...)
